Another powerful
Boston real estate agent has joined Gibson Sothebys International
Realty. Toni Gilardi, the
former owner of Elite Boston Landmark Realty for 31 years,
consistently ranks as one of the top agents in the historic North
End/ Waterfront. As part of Gibson Sothebys International Realty,
Toni and her team will continue to cater to the individual needs of
each client and provide white glove service for which the Sothebys
brand is known. A native of Bostons North End neighborhood, Toni
has been a community fixture for decades.
Gibson Sothebys International Realty has moved into the former
Elite Boston Landmark Realty office space at 350 Commercial Street.
Located conveniently on Bostons Historic Freedom Trail, the Gibson
Sothebys International Realtys Waterfront office will take full
advantage of this new, visible space located directly across from
Battery Wharf.

This roll-in continues the dramatic growth that Gibson Sothebys
International Realty has seen over the past 12 months, which
started with the addition of one of Bostons top producing agents,
Michael Carucci. Additionally Gibson Sothebys International Realty
opened a brand new office this past May in Cambridge, where they
added several well-known agents to their team. Lastly, the firm is
in the process of doubling the size of its Back Bay office located
at the corner of Newbury and Dartmouth Streets.
Gibson Sothebys International Realty is expecting to see this
growth continue into the New Year.
